Key Responsibilities
• Identify, assess, and document strategic, operational, financial, and compliance risks across business units.
• Develop and maintain enterprise risk registers and ensure risks are regularly updated and reviewed.
• Monitor key risk indicators (KRIs) and track risk exposure against defined risk appetite thresholds.
• Facilitate risk assessment workshops and collaborate with departments to identify and evaluate risks.
• Perform risk analysis, including likelihood and impact assessments, and recommend mitigation strategies.
• Prepare and present risk reports, dashboards, and insights to management and stakeholders.
• Ensure integration of risk management into business planning and decision-making processes.
• Track and follow up on risk mitigation actions and ensure timely implementation.
• Conduct scenario analysis and stress testing to evaluate potential risk impacts.
• Support compliance with regulatory requirements and risk governance standards.
• Promote a strong risk culture through training, awareness, and stakeholder engagement.
